Kardahuli - Jale, Darbhanga

Kardahuli is a village situated in the Jale subdivision of Darbhanga district, Bihar. It is located approximately 16 km from the tehsil headquarters in Jale and around 36 km from the district headquarters in Darbhanga. Karwa Tariyani serves as the Gram Panchayat for Kardahuli village.

As per Census 2011, the village code of Kardahuli is 226739. The village covers a total geographical area of 62 hectares and falls under the 847303 pincode. Darbhanga is the nearest town, located about 36 km away.

Kardahuli village is governed under the Panchayati Raj system, with a Mukhiya serving as the elected head.

Population of Kardahuli

According to the 2011 Census, Kardahuli village had a total population of 1,839 people, including 969 males and 870 females, living in 345 households. The sex ratio was 898 females per 1,000 males. The overall literacy rate was 31.18%, with male literacy at 43.41% and female literacy at 17.37%. The Scheduled Caste (SC) population was 19.

The table below presents a detailed demographic breakdown of the village, including separate male and female figures for each population category.

Category Total Male Female
Total Population1,839969870
Child Population (0–6 yrs)367188179
Scheduled Castes (SC)19712
Scheduled Tribes (ST)000
Literate Population459339120
Illiterate Population1,380630750

Transport and Connectivity of Kardahuli

Public transport facilities are available within 5-10 km of the Kardahuli. The nearest railway station is located within 5-10 km of Kardahuli.

ConnectivityStatusNearest Availability
Public Bus ServiceNoAvailable within <5 km
Private Bus ServiceNoAvailable within <5 km
Railway StationNoAvailable within 5-10 km

In addition to basic transport facilities, distances and travel times help define overall connectivity. The road distance from Darbhanga to Kardahuli is about 36 km, with a usual travel time of around 1-1.25 hours. Actual travel time may vary depending on road conditions and mode of transport.
